Manuel Carnero is a scholar working on Cardiology and Cardiovascular Medicine, Surgery and Epidemiology. According to data from OpenAlex, Manuel Carnero has authored 104 papers receiving a total of 597 indexed citations (citations by other indexed papers that have themselves been cited), including 85 papers in Cardiology and Cardiovascular Medicine, 53 papers in Surgery and 43 papers in Epidemiology. Recurrent topics in Manuel Carnero's work include Cardiac Valve Diseases and Treatments (64 papers), Infective Endocarditis Diagnosis and Management (38 papers) and Cardiac Structural Anomalies and Repair (25 papers). Manuel Carnero is often cited by papers focused on Cardiac Valve Diseases and Treatments (64 papers), Infective Endocarditis Diagnosis and Management (38 papers) and Cardiac Structural Anomalies and Repair (25 papers). Manuel Carnero collaborates with scholars based in Spain, United States and Switzerland. Manuel Carnero's co-authors include Isidre Vilacosta, Luis Maroto, Javier Cobiella, José E. Rodríguez, Jacobo Silva, Santiago Redondo, Emilio Muñoz Ruiz, Antonio Gordillo‐Moscoso, Enrique Rodrı́guez and Carmen Olmos and has published in prestigious journals such as Circulation, SHILAP Revista de lepidopterología and PLoS ONE.
